Our Services

Strategic Ecological Assessment

For landowners, developers, and project managers who aren't sure how and where to start. A paid site evaluation that delivers an invasive pressure diagnosis, risk classification, and phased management pathway.

Ecological Rebuild

For sites that need more than a little help — degraded land converted into a resilient, self-sustaining native ecosystem. A structured multi-year program combining invasive suppression, native planting, soil stabilization, irrigation integrations, and brose protection.

Vegetation Risk Management

For developers or industrial landowners managing active or deferred sites under regulatory exposure. Biologically timed herbicide containment programs. Single or multi-year with compliance documentation, spray logs, and GIS tracking. Structured to run alongside your build cycle without disrupting it.

Pond & Specialty Infrastructure Restoration

For retention ponds, drainage systems, and ecological infrastructure that have stopped performing. A concentrated, equipment-driven reset: mechanical invasive removal, sediment extraction, basin reconfiguration, and native replanting. Fish window scheduling and QEP coordination handled where required.

Ecological Management

Ongoing vegetation management for ecosystem focused parks and greenspaces. Biologically timed visits — integrating mechanical and chemical treatment with native reinforcement planting and site documentation. Available as multi-site agreements for municipalities and developers managing multiple properties.

Sellentin’s Habitat Restoration & Invasive Species Consulting LTD. provides expert environmental restoration and vegetation management services on Vancouver Island. Based in Victoria and the Comox Valley, we advise and execute projects on both private and public land, addressing complex landscape and infrastructure challenges. Our work spans parks, natural areas, brownfield sites, roadways, hydro corridors, and pipeline routes. Clients include regional districts, municipalities, developers, private landowners, utilities, and conservation organizations.
